In July 2009, Kevin Mather was on a training ride in the foothills of Los Angeles with a group of friends when he was hit by a truck. His athletic pursuits continued on. Like a story in a book, his athletic career went through various chapters. Early on, he focused on competing in marathons, triathlons, and even Ironman competitions. He would finish first in his category at the L.A. Marathon in 2012 and then finished second that year at the Ironman World Championship in Kona, Hawaii. Afterwards, he would pursue alpine skiing and was a member of the U.S. Paralympic ski team. In 2017, he got serious about archery and would win the gold medal at the Paralympic Games in Tokyo.
